Kaip naudoti komandą Rasti ieškant sistemoje Windows
Langai Komandinė Eilutė / / March 16, 2020
Paskutinį kartą atnaujinta
Ar „Windows“ paieška jums per lėta? Sužinokite, kaip pagreitinti paiešką, naudojant komandų eilutės lange rastą komandą.
„Windows“ turi keletą integruotų paieškos galimybių, tačiau jos gali nepatikti. „Cortana“ arba standartinis paieškos laukelis užduočių juostoje ir ieškos laukas „File Explorer“ sistemoje „Windows 10“ leidžia ieškoti pagal failų turinį, bet jie gali būti lėti, ypač „File Explorer“ Paieška.
Yra greitesnis būdas ieškoti failų kietajame diske naudojant komandinę eilutę. rasti komanda ieško teksto eilučių failuose ir grąžina teksto eilutes iš failų, kuriuose rasta teksto eilutė.
PASTABA: rasti komanda netinka dideliems failams ar dideliam failų skaičiui.
Šiandien aptarsime, kaip naudoti rasti komandą ir pateiksime keletą pavyzdžių.
Atidarykite komandų eilutės langą su administravimo privilegijomis
„Command Prompt“ lango atidarymas kaip administratoriaus nėra būtinas. Tačiau tai padeda išvengti erzinančių patvirtinimo dialogo langų. Tiesiog būkite atsargūs, kokias komandas vykdote kaip administratorius komandų eilutėje. Naudojant
Įveskite cmd.exe viduje Paieška langelį užduočių juostoje. Tada dešiniuoju pelės mygtuku spustelėkite Komandinė eilutė punktas pagal Geriausias atitikimas ir pasirinkite Vykdyti kaip administratorius iš iššokančiojo meniu.
Jei Vartotojo abonemento kontrolė pasirodo dialogo langas, spustelėkite Taip tęsti.
PASTABA: Galbūt nematysite šio dialogo lango, atsižvelgiant į jūsų Vartotojo abonemento valdymo nustatymai. Nerekomenduojame visiškai išjungti UAC.
Komandų suradimai ir parametrai
Daugelyje komandų yra pasirenkami jungikliai, modifikuojantys numatytąjį komandos veikimą. Norėdami pamatyti visus galimus jungiklius, galite gauti pagalbos rasti komandą, eilutėje įvedę šią eilutę ir paspausdami Įveskite.
rasti /?
Jungikliai gali būti mažosios arba didžiosios raidės.
Už „Styga“ parametrą, turite apjuosti eilutę dvigubomis kabutėmis, priešingu atveju rasti komanda neveiks ir grįš klaida.
[diskas:] [kelias] failo vardas parametras gali būti bet koks - nuo disko raidės iki vieno failo ar kelių failų.
Rasti komandos sintaksė
Komandos sintaksė yra konkretus būdas organizuoti komandą ir jos jungiklius bei parametrus. Toliau pateikiama bendroji paieškos komandos sintaksė.
rasti [jungikliai] „eilutė“ [kelio pavadinimas (-ai)]
Jungikliai gali būti bet kokia tvarka tol, kol jie yra prieš „Styga“ parametras. Skliausteliuose [] nurodoma, kad jungiklis ar parametras yra neprivalomi.
Ieškokite teksto eilutės viename dokumente
Pirmiausia parodysime, kaip ieškoti vieno dokumento visose teksto eilutėse. Ši komanda ieško „example1.txt“ failo frazės „groovypost is the best tech site“.
rasti "groovypost yra geriausia technologijų svetainė" "C: \ Users \ Lori \ Documents \ FindCommandExamples \ example1.txt"
PASTABA: Jei bet kurioje kelio dalyje ar failo pavadinime yra tarpelių, apie visą kelią turite rašyti citatas, kaip mes darėme aukščiau esančioje komandoje. Citatos šiuo atveju tikrai nereikalingos, tačiau nepakenkti jų turėjimas.
Atminkite, kad frazė aukščiau pateiktame pavyzdyje nerasta (nieko nenurodyta žemiau kelio į failą), net jei ji yra byloje. Taip yra todėl, kad atvejis „groovypost“ neatitiko to, kas buvo byloje, kuris yra „groovyPost“. Pridėkite „/ i“(Mažosiomis arba didžiosiomis raidėmis„ i “) pasukite dešinėn po paieškos komandos (prieš frazę), kad nekreiptumėte dėmesio į didžiųjų raidžių raidę ieškant teksto.
rasti / i "groovypost yra geriausia technologijų svetainė" "C: \ Users \ Lori \ Documents \ FindCommandExamples \ example1.txt"
Dabar frazė buvo rasta ir visa eilutė, kurioje yra frazė, atspausdinama į ekraną, esantį žemiau ieškomos bylos failo.
Ieškokite keliuose dokumentuose tos pačios teksto eilutės
Dabar, kai viename faile galite ieškoti teksto eilutės, ieškokime kelių failų ta pačia teksto eilute.
Galite nurodyti kelis failus, kuriuos reikia ieškoti ieškant komandoje, įvesdami kiekvieno failo kelią kabutėmis, atskirtomis tarpais.
rasti / i "groovypost" "C: \ Users \ Lori \ Documents \ FindCommandExamples \ example1.txt" "C: \ Users \ Lori \ Documents \ FindCommandExamples \ example2.txt"
Taip pat galite ieškoti visų teksto failų kataloge naudodami pakaitos ženklą, kuris yra žvaigždutė (*), kaip parodyta šioje komandoje.
rasti / i "groovypost" "C: \ Vartotojai \ Lori \ Dokumentai \ FindCommandExamples \ *. txt"
Paieškos terminas buvo rastas abiejuose dokumentuose, o sakiniai, kuriuose jie buvo rasti, yra išvardyti po visą kelią į kiekvieną bylą.
Suskaičiuokite failų eilučių skaičių
Jei norite sužinoti, kiek eilučių yra faile, galite naudoti tipo ir rasti komandos. tipo komanda rodo vieno ar daugiau tekstinių failų turinį.
Mes įtraukėme į tipo komandą į rasti komanda naudodama vertikalią juostą (|). Mes panaudojome „/ vPerjungti, kad būtų rodomos visos eilutės, kuriose nėra “” eilutė, taigi kiekviena eilutė su tekstu bus suskaičiuota. Kad teksto faile būtų rodomas tik eilučių skaičius (ne pačios eilutės), naudojame „/ cJungiklis.
įveskite C: \ Users \ Lori \ Documents \ FindCommandExamples \ example1.txt | rasti „“ / v / c
Nusiųskite kitos komandos išvestį komandai „Rasti“
Taip pat galite ieškoti visų failų pavadinimų kataloge tam tikros eilutės, įvesdami rež komanda rasti komanda.
Pvz., Mes gavome katalogą C: \ Vartotojai \ Lori \ Dokumentai \ FindCommandExamples katalogą ir visus to katalogo pakatalogius („/ sJungiklis). Mes taip pat nurodėme naudoti pliką formatą be jokios antraštės informacijos ar santraukos („/ bPerjungti) ir rodyti sąrašą tokiu pat formatu, kaip ir plataus sąrašo formatą („/ wJungiklis), bet rūšiuojami pagal stulpelį („/ dJungiklis).
Tada mes įterpiame (|) dir komandos išvestį į komandą find, tik pridėdami "pavyzdys" kaip parametras. Prie radimo komandos nepridėjome jokių jungiklių. Failų pavadinimai, kurių reikia ieškoti, yra iš rež komanda.
dir "C: \ Vartotojai \ Lori \ Dokumentai \ FindCommandExamples" / s / b / d | rasti „pavyzdį“
Ar norėtumėte „File Explorer“ naudoti komandą „rasti“ arba „Ieškoti“? Kaip pasinaudojote komanda „surasti“? Pasidalykite savo idėjomis ir pavyzdžiais su mumis komentaruose žemiau.